首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

oracle到mysql定时同步数据库

Oracle到MySQL定时同步数据库是一种数据备份和复制策略,用于将Oracle数据库中的数据定期同步到MySQL数据库中。这种同步方法可以确保数据在不同数据库之间的一致性,并提供容灾和高可用性。

Oracle到MySQL定时同步数据库的实现可以通过以下步骤完成:

  1. 数据库连接设置:首先,需要确保能够连接到Oracle和MySQL数据库。可以使用相应的数据库连接库(如Oracle JDBC驱动和MySQL Connector/J)来建立连接。
  2. 数据导出:使用Oracle的导出工具(如expdp)将需要同步的数据导出为可转换的格式,如CSV、JSON或XML。
  3. 数据转换:对导出的数据进行格式转换,以便能够被MySQL接受并正确导入。这可以使用脚本或ETL工具来完成。
  4. 数据导入:使用MySQL的导入工具(如mysqlimport)将转换后的数据导入到MySQL数据库中。确保在导入之前已创建相应的表结构。
  5. 定时任务设置:使用定时任务工具(如cron)设置定期执行数据同步的时间间隔。可以根据实际需求选择同步频率,如每小时、每天或每周。

Oracle到MySQL定时同步数据库的优势包括:

  1. 数据备份和复制:通过定时同步,可以实现对Oracle数据的备份和复制,以提供数据的冗余和容灾能力。
  2. 跨平台兼容性:MySQL是一个广泛使用的开源关系型数据库,能够在多个平台上运行。通过将数据同步到MySQL,可以实现跨平台兼容性,以便在不同环境中访问和处理数据。
  3. 高可用性:通过将数据同步到MySQL数据库,可以实现在Oracle数据库不可用时,快速切换到MySQL数据库以提供持续的服务和数据访问能力。

Oracle到MySQL定时同步数据库的应用场景包括:

  1. 数据备份与恢复:将Oracle数据库定期同步到MySQL数据库,以提供数据的冗余备份和灾难恢复能力。
  2. 数据迁移与集成:当需要将Oracle数据库迁移到MySQL数据库时,可以使用定时同步方法,确保数据的完整性和一致性。
  3. 多数据源管理:当需要从多个数据源中聚合数据并进行统一管理时,可以使用定时同步方法将不同数据源的数据同步到MySQL数据库中,以便进行进一步的数据处理和分析。

腾讯云提供了多种与数据库相关的产品和服务,例如:

  1. 云数据库 MySQL:腾讯云提供的托管式MySQL数据库服务,可提供稳定可靠的数据库服务,支持高可用、自动备份等功能。详情请参考:云数据库 MySQL
  2. 云数据库数据传输服务 DTS:腾讯云提供的数据迁移与同步服务,支持Oracle到MySQL数据库的数据迁移和同步。详情请参考:云数据库数据传输服务 DTS

请注意,以上只是一种可能的实现方式和相关产品介绍,实际应用中还需要根据具体需求和场景进行选择和配置。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分25秒

etl engine 通过CDC模式实时同步MySQL增量数据到Elastic数据库

378
4分30秒

数据库(MYSQL/ORACLE)压测脚本分享

12分24秒

etl engine 通过MySQL binlog 模式 实现增量同步数据到 各种数据库

689
9分40秒

etl engine CDC模式实时同步postgre增量数据解决方案

391
1分9秒

DBeaver介绍

22分28秒

112-Oracle中SQL执行流程_缓冲池的使用

34分56秒

192-一主一从架构搭建与主从同步的实现

14分17秒

194-数据同步一致性问题解决

16分2秒

尚硅谷-02-为什么使用数据库及数据库常用概念

28分46秒

159-数据库调优整体步骤、优化MySQL服务器硬件和参数

26分38秒

150-淘宝数据库的主键如何设计

37分54秒

尚硅谷-49-数据库的创建、修改与删除

领券